Prime Factorization of 1745

What is the Prime Factorization of 1745?

Answer: Prime Factors of 1745: 5, 349

Explanation of number 1745 Prime Factorization

Prime Factorization of 1745 it is expressing 1745 as the product of prime factors. In other words it is finding which prime numbers should be multiplied together to make 1745.

Since number 1745 is a Composite number (not Prime) we can do its Prime Factorization.

To get a list of all Prime Factors of 1745, we have to iteratively divide 1745 by the smallest prime number possible until the result equals 1.

Here is the complete solution of finding Prime Factors of 1745:

The smallest Prime Number which can divide 1745 without a remainder is 5. So the first calculation step would look like:

1745 ÷ 5 = 349

Now we repeat this action until the result equals 1:

349 ÷ 349 = 1

Now we have all the Prime Factors for number 1745. It is: 5, 349
